What is the meaning of 64 QAM?
64-qam definition A variation on the quadrature amplitude modulation (QAM) signal modulation scheme. 64-QAM yields 64 possible signal combinations, with each symbol representing six bits (2 6 = 64). The yield of this complex modulation scheme is that the transmission rate is six times the signaling rate.
What is the bandwidth of QPSK?
QPSK transmits two bits per symbol, so the bit rate for QPSK is 2T. It follows that QPSK can transmit 2 bits per Hz of bandwidth at baseband, and 1 bit per Hz at passband.

What is meant by QPSK modulation?
Quadrature Phase Shift Keying (QPSK) is a form of Phase Shift Keying in which two bits are modulated at once, selecting one of four possible carrier phase shifts (0, 90, 180, or 270 degrees). QPSK allows the signal to carry twice as much information as ordinary PSK using the same bandwidth.

What is QAM modulation technique?
This modulation technique is a combination of both Amplitude and phase modulation techniques. QAM is better than QPSK in terms of data carrying capacity. QAM takes benefit from the concept that two signal frequencies; one shifted by 90 degree with respect to the other can be transmitted on the same carrier.
What is the difference between QPSK and 16QAM?
QPSK has – 4 constellation points; 16 QAM -16 constellation points; 64 – 64 constellation points. 16QAM vs QPSK -> Now with the 16 possible points in the constellation diagram we have 16 possible symbols. For this 16 symbols we need 4 bits for coding .
How is the QPSK diagram constructed?
The QPSK diagram is constructed using four points over the constellation diagram, placed with equal spacing around the circle. Using four phases, the encoding in QPSK involves 2 bits in each symbol with grey coding to reduce the bit error rate (BER).
